Digital radio licence categories

A category 1 digital radio multiplex transmitter licence is a licence that provides for the transmission of any or all of the following services:

  • one or more digital commercial radio broadcasting services;
  • one or more digital community radio broadcasting services;
  • one or more restricted datacasting services.

A category 2 digital radio multiplex transmitter licence is a licence that provides for the transmission of any or all of the following services:

  • one or more digital commercial radio broadcasting services;
  • one or more digital community radio broadcasting services;
  • one or more digital national radio broadcasting services;
  • one or more restricted datacasting services.

A category 3 digital radio multiplex transmitter licence is a licence that provides for the transmission of:

  • one or more digital national radio broadcasting services;
  • one or more restricted datacasting services, where each relevant restricted datacasting licence is held by a national broadcaster.
